
St Cirq Lapopie another tourist town overlooking the river Lot with lots of interesting old buildings & plenty of shops!!.

Rocamadour is a beautiful old town built into the rocks. Very popular with tourists.

Every Sunday morning there is a thriving market in Montcuq with Loads of stalls selling things from clothes household items to the local produce like bread cheeses vegetables & of course the local wines.

The Cafe du Centre is a popular meeting place for coffees. This day there was a folk group entertaining the tired shoppers.
